Embodiment 1

[0029] A method for constructing a laying hen enteritis model, comprising the following steps:

[0030] Step 1. Select 50 Roman pink laying hens during the peak egg production period (28 weeks of age), adopt a single factor experimental design, set up treatment, each treatment has 10 repetitions, and each repetition is 1 chicken, and 10 mL of normal saline is administered to the stomach respectively (control group, CON) and four 10mL challenge treatment groups ( figure 1 ).

[0031] Wherein, the specific operation method of the challenge treatment group is, coccidia vaccine (200 times weak toxicity coccidia quadrivalent vaccine, containing 220,000 coccidia spores) + different gradients of Clostridium perfringens type A treatment group, The doses of different gradients of Clostridium perfringens type A were: 1mL (T1), 2mL (T2), 3mL bacterial liquid (T3) and 4mL bacterial liquid (T4). Abstract

The invention discloses a method for constructing an enteritis model of laying hens, comprising the following steps: selecting 40 Roman pink laying hens during the peak laying period, and setting up treatments, which are respectively a control group and four challenge treatment groups; the challenge treatment group Coccidia vaccine + different gradients of Clostridium perfringens type A treatment group, respectively, at 9:00 every morning after the start of the test, the coccidia vaccine was given first, and then the Clostridium perfringens bacteria solution was given half an hour later. Sampling was carried out 48 hours after the last feeding; the test period was 7 days, the diet was corn-soybean meal-based diet, and the feeding and management were carried out according to conventional feeding and management. The invention can explore the specific mechanism of the decline in production performance of laying hens caused by nutrition and feed factors, stress and other factors.

technical field [0001] The invention belongs to the technical field of animal nutrition and toxicology, and in particular relates to a method for constructing a laying hen enteritis model. Background technique [0002] The small intestine of animals is an important part of the digestion and absorption of nutrients, and it is also the largest immune organ of the body. A large number of studies have shown that intestinal diseases in chickens will affect the digestion and absorption of nutrients, resulting in a decline in production performance and feed conversion efficiency, which will seriously lead to the death of chickens and seriously restrict the development of the poultry industry. Chicken enteritis is one of the most prominent enteric diseases in the intensive production of modern poultry, which has brought huge economic losses to the poultry industry.
